Arsene Wenger to revive Salomon Kalou interest

Wenger to revive Kalou interest

Arsenal manager Arsene Wenger is weighing up whether to make a second bid for Chelsea attacker Salomon Kalou.

The Gunners boss had an offer for the Ivorian turned down three years ago when Luiz Felipe Scolari was in charge at Stamford Bridge.

However, current Blues manager Andre Villas-Boas is now willing to listen to any offers for the 26-year-old, according to The People.

Kalou, who joined Chelsea in 2006, is currently down the pecking order at Chelsea with Fernando Torres, Didier Drogba, Daniel Sturridge and Romelu Lukaku all preferred in recent starting lineups.
